Richard Burnton from Living Hope MinistriesI was born in November 1949. However, it was as a 13 year old that I first found Christ as my Saviour. I attended a Baptist church in Fakenham, and found Norfolk was to present opportunities to preach - almost immediately after my conversion - in the open air in some of the surrounding Norfolk villages. I preached my first in-church sermon in a Railway Mission in Melton Constable, still only 15.

I was discovering that God had a work for me to do and, although in so many areas I felt lacking and inadequate, I was joyfully discovering that God had a purpose for my life, and a work for me to do.

At 17 years, I sensed clearly God's call to full time ministry, but it was to be 23 years later that the door opened for that. The Lord spoke about a big work in store that would involve speaking to crowds; but I never really took that in.
While waiting, there were many doors of service, including spare and part time pastoring. Although waiting for full time ministry was difficult, I knew that God had called me and had impressed upon me, as a teenager, the scriptures from 1 Peter 5 and 2 Timothy 3.

The door through which I entered full time ministry was to prove a great challenge, and it was totally unexpected when the Lord took me to Africa in November 1994. He told me He was to do a "new thing". This "new thing", I discovered, would be working with 25 churches in the UK rather than pastoring a church. This would support ministry in Kenya, Uganda, Tanzania and Rwanda, and has included Spain, New Jersey and Chicago. It involves writing to over 600 pastors and leaders, making television programmes and radio programmes.

Sending Bible studies, teaching tapes and arranging seminars for pastors are all now a big part of my life. Most importantly, the new thing involves my wife Elaine, and the boys.
